Brenda Faye Oliver was born on February 19, 1954, in Cleveland, GA, and passed away at 2:40am on June 26, 2023.
She is survived by her loving husband of 45 years, David Ronald Oliver; Daughters Erinn (Elijah) Williams of Dallas, GA, and Emily (Adam) Tingen of Winston Salem, NC; grandchildren Reed, Nash and Dessa Williams, and Caleb and Riley Tingen; and her sister Barbara Sue Meyer of Lawrenceville, GA.
Brenda attended Toccoa Falls High School in Toccoa, GA and formerly worked for Coca Cola and as a registered dietician at Teasley Elementary in Smyrna, GA. She spent most of her years as a loving mother and housewife, and she adored her grandbabies and loved to buy them things they didn’t need just because she could.She had a gentle soul with a penchant for gambling and junk food and she could often be found sitting on her front porch enjoying her coffee and watching the birds.
One thing you could always count on with Brenda was her calling to sing you Happy Birthday on your special day. She also had a fondness for knick-knacks and catalogs, and she truly was a people person that never met a stranger. She had a knack for learning someone’s life story within minutes of meeting them and could make the hardest person open up and share with her. Even a delivery person would make a stop and leave with her as their friend, she was just that type of person.
A Celebration of Life will be held at the family home at a date still to be determined.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to your favorite charity in her honor.
